Britannica says that it is a genre of rock.
Encyclopedia Britannica said:
Heavy Metal
genre of rock music that includes a group of related styles that are intense, virtuosic, and powerful. Driven by the aggressive sounds of the distorted electric guitar, heavy metal is arguably the most commercially successful genre of rock music.

I don't actually have a problem with people calling it techno/electronica if they like the stuff. It's just the people that say "techno sucks" make me turn to over genrefying everything.

As for what to call it, I generally call the whole shennanigan EDM for electronic dance music (its too broad a subject to call it much else). Electronica tends to refer to stuff like prodigy and similar kinds of breaks.
